A PowerShell egy rendkívül hasznos eszköz a rendszergazdák és fejlesztők számára, amely lehetővé teszi számukra a rendszerük automatizálását és a feladatok egyszerűsítését. Egyik hasznos parancslet, amit a PowerShell kínál, az az Out-GridView. Ez a parancslet lehetővé teszi a parancssorból visszaadott adatok megjelenítését egy grafikus táblázatban, ami a vizuális elemzést és az adatokkal való interakciót egyszerűbbé teszi.

Mi az Out-GridView parancs?

Az Out-GridView egy PowerShell cmdlet, amely egy ablakot nyit meg, hogy megjelenítse az input objektumokat egy táblázatos formában. A felhasználók szűrőket alkalmazhatnak, rendezhetik az adatokat, és még kiválaszthatnak sorokat a visszaküldéshez a PowerShellbe. Ez a funkcionalitás nagyon hasznos, amikor valaki azonnali emberi elemzést végez az adatokon, vagy ha csak egyszerűen vizuális formában szeretné áttekinteni az információkat.

Az Out-GridView erőssége abban rejlik, hogy megkönnyíti a nagy mennyiségű adat gyors átnézését és manipulálását. Legyen szó fájlrendszerekről, hálózati beállításokról vagy akár olyan komplex adatstruktúrákról, mint az XML vagy JSON, az Out-GridView segítségével könnyedén szűrhető és áttekinthető az információ.

Hogyan használjuk az Out-GridView-t?

A cmdlet használatát a legjobban példákon keresztül lehet megérteni.

Get-Process | Out-GridView

Ez a parancs megjeleníti az összes folyamatot a rendszeren egy grafikus ablakban. Itt a felhasználók könnyedén szűrhetik és böngészhetik a folyamatokat.

Vegyünk egy másik példát, ahol szűrni szeretnénk az adatokat még mielőtt az Out-GridView-ba kerülnének:

Get-Service | Where-Object { $_.Status -eq 'Running' } | Out-GridView

Ebben a példában csak azok a szolgáltatások jelennek meg, amelyek éppen futnak. Ez lehetővé teszi a felhasználók számára, hogy gyorsan szűrjön egy adott feltétel alapján, mielőtt az adatok egy grafikus felületen jelennek meg.

Továbbá, az Out-GridView használható interaktív választóként is, ha a -PassThru kapcsolót használjuk. Például:

$selected = Get-Process | Out-GridView -PassThru

Ebben a példában a felhasználó kiválaszthat egy vagy több folyamatot a grafikus felületen, és a választott objektumok hozzárendelődnek a $selected változóhoz. Ez egy nagyon hasznos technika, amikor konkrét elemekkel szeretnénk dolgozni a PowerShellben.

Az Out-GridView a PowerShell egyik olyan eszköze, amely jelentősen megkönnyítheti az adatok vizuális manipulációját és elemzését. Használata rendkívül egyszerű, és számos helyzetben lehet alkalmazni, ahol gyors áttekintésre vagy adatelemzésre van szükség. Az itt bemutatott példák csak a felszínt karcolják, de remélhetőleg felkeltették az érdeklődést e hasznos cmdlet iránt, amely sokféleképpen bővítheti a PowerShell használati lehetőségeit.

About The Author

Vélemény, hozzászólás?

Az e-mail cím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ük